This is an automated email from the ASF dual-hosted git repository.

xiaoxiang p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/nuttx.git


The following commit(s) were added to refs/heads/master by this push:
     new 111a0746c2 arm64: change name saved_reg to saved_regs
111a0746c2 is described below

commit 111a0746c2cb20954850942b75fb318115a5292a
Author: hujun5 <huj...@xiaomi.com>
AuthorDate: Tue Nov 26 08:02:11 2024 +0800

    arm64: change name saved_reg to saved_regs
    
    reason:
    saved_regs is more meaningful and used by all other arch
    
    Signed-off-by: hujun5 <huj...@xiaomi.com>
---
 arch/arm64/include/irq.h                        | 2 +-
 arch/arm64/src/common/arm64_schedulesigaction.c | 2 +-
 arch/arm64/src/common/arm64_sigdeliver.c        | 4 ++--
 3 files changed, 4 insertions(+), 4 deletions(-)

diff --git a/arch/arm64/include/irq.h b/arch/arm64/include/irq.h
index 3c67bca579..7e2fe51056 100644
--- a/arch/arm64/include/irq.h
+++ b/arch/arm64/include/irq.h
@@ -270,7 +270,7 @@ struct xcptcontext
 
   /* task context, for signal process */
 
-  uint64_t *saved_reg;
+  uint64_t *saved_regs;
 
 #ifdef CONFIG_ARCH_FPU
   uint64_t *fpu_regs;
diff --git a/arch/arm64/src/common/arm64_schedulesigaction.c 
b/arch/arm64/src/common/arm64_schedulesigaction.c
index 737e0ba1a9..91cad79b51 100644
--- a/arch/arm64/src/common/arm64_schedulesigaction.c
+++ b/arch/arm64/src/common/arm64_schedulesigaction.c
@@ -138,7 +138,7 @@ void up_schedule_sigaction(struct tcb_s *tcb)
        * have been delivered.
        */
 
-      tcb->xcp.saved_reg = tcb->xcp.regs;
+      tcb->xcp.saved_regs = tcb->xcp.regs;
 
       /* create signal process context */
 
diff --git a/arch/arm64/src/common/arm64_sigdeliver.c 
b/arch/arm64/src/common/arm64_sigdeliver.c
index 0994678428..6c283e43b8 100644
--- a/arch/arm64/src/common/arm64_sigdeliver.c
+++ b/arch/arm64/src/common/arm64_sigdeliver.c
@@ -64,7 +64,7 @@ void arm64_sigdeliver(void)
 
   irqstate_t  flags;
   int16_t saved_irqcount;
-  flags = (rtcb->xcp.saved_reg[REG_SPSR] & SPSR_DAIF_MASK);
+  flags = (rtcb->xcp.saved_regs[REG_SPSR] & SPSR_DAIF_MASK);
 #endif
 
   sinfo("rtcb=%p sigdeliver=%p sigpendactionq.head=%p\n",
@@ -149,7 +149,7 @@ retry:
    */
 
   rtcb->sigdeliver = NULL;  /* Allows next handler to be scheduled */
-  rtcb->xcp.regs = rtcb->xcp.saved_reg;
+  rtcb->xcp.regs = rtcb->xcp.saved_regs;
 
   /* Then restore the correct state for this thread of execution. */
 

Reply via email to